FAQs

1. What is the shelf life of this 0.1M hydrochloric acid solution?

The solution remains stable for 12 months from the date of manufacture when stored in a tightly sealed container at room temperature, away from direct sunlight and moisture.

2. Is this solution pre-standardized, or does it require further calibration?

This hydrochloric acid solution is pre-standardized to 0.1M (0.1N) and does not require additional calibration for most routine titration applications.

3. Can this solution be used for non-aqueous titrations?

This solution is specifically formulated for aqueous titrations and may not be suitable for non-aqueous systems without prior validation.

4. What material is the container made of, and is it resistant to chemical corrosion?

The solution is packaged in a high-density polyethylene (HDPE) container, which is chemically resistant to hydrochloric acid and prevents leakage or contamination.

5. Are there any special disposal guidelines for this solution?

Follow standard laboratory protocols for acidic waste disposal. Neutralize with a suitable base before disposal in accordance with local environmental regulations.
